取消
顯示的結果
而不是尋找
你的意思是:

是否取消工作運行回滾任何行動執行的查詢計劃嗎?

brendanc19
新的貢獻者三世

如果我停止運行一個相當大的工作,說一半通過執行,將δ表上持續進行的任何行為或他們會回滾嗎?

還有其他我需要注意的風險取消工作運行通過一半的路嗎?

1接受解決方案

接受的解決方案

匿名
不適用

@Brendan凱裏:

如果你停止運行的執行工作,任何行動,已經致力於δ表將持續下去。然而,任何未提交的更改的工作將回滾。這意味著任何事務都在進步的工作中斷,將破壞和三角洲表將會恢複到之前的狀態。

重要的是要注意,當你停止運行的執行工作,你可能引入不一致的數據。例如,如果工作是更新多個表和你停止更新完成之前,一些表可能是當別人沒有更新,導致不一致的數據。此外,如果工作是在執行的過程中一些關鍵的或不可逆的操作,比如刪除或覆蓋數據,停止工作運行中可能產生無法預料的後果。

減輕風險的停止運行的執行工作,它是一個很好的實踐設計作業的方式允許安全的停止和重新啟動。例如,你可以你的工作分解成更小、原子步驟,可以獨立運行,並使用檢查點,以確保成功完成每一步之前移動到下一個。您還可以使用日誌記錄和監控工具的進步跟蹤你的工作和識別任何問題之前,他們變得至關重要。

在原帖子查看解決方案

5回複5

匿名
不適用

@Brendan凱裏:

如果你停止運行的執行工作,任何行動,已經致力於δ表將持續下去。然而,任何未提交的更改的工作將回滾。這意味著任何事務都在進步的工作中斷,將破壞和三角洲表將會恢複到之前的狀態。

重要的是要注意,當你停止運行的執行工作,你可能引入不一致的數據。例如,如果工作是更新多個表和你停止更新完成之前,一些表可能是當別人沒有更新,導致不一致的數據。此外,如果工作是在執行的過程中一些關鍵的或不可逆的操作,比如刪除或覆蓋數據,停止工作運行中可能產生無法預料的後果。

減輕風險的停止運行的執行工作,它是一個很好的實踐設計作業的方式允許安全的停止和重新啟動。例如,你可以你的工作分解成更小、原子步驟,可以獨立運行,並使用檢查點,以確保成功完成每一步之前移動到下一個。您還可以使用日誌記錄和監控工具的進步跟蹤你的工作和識別任何問題之前,他們變得至關重要。

brendanc19
新的貢獻者三世

謝謝@Suteja卡努裏人

匿名
不適用

歡迎你!快樂的學習

Vartika
主持人
主持人

嘿@Brendan凱裏

希望一切進行得很順利。

隻是想檢查如果你能解決你的問題。如果是的,你會很高興馬克@Suteja卡努裏人的回答是最好的,其他成員可以找到解決方案更快嗎?如果不是,請告訴我們,我們可以幫助你。

幹杯!

歡迎來到磚社區:讓學習、網絡和一起慶祝

加入我們的快速增長的數據專業人員和專家的80 k +社區成員,準備發現,幫助和合作而做出有意義的聯係。

點擊在這裏注冊今天,加入!

參與令人興奮的技術討論,加入一個組與你的同事和滿足我們的成員。

Baidu
map